There are several kinds of keys that can be duplicated, each with its own special attributes:
1. Standard Keys
Conventional car keys are made from metal and have a basic cut pattern. They are simple to duplicate at most hardware stores and locksmiths.
2. Transponder Keys
Transponder keys come geared up with a microchip that interacts with the car's ignition system. Replicating these keys typically requires specialized equipment and programming, making it a more intricate and costly procedure.
3. Key Fobs
Key fobs or remote entry keys are electronic gadgets that enable you to unlock and begin your car remotely. Making duplicates might involve not just cutting the physical key but also programming the fob, which can be done at car dealerships or specialized locksmith professionals.
4. Smart Keys
Smart keys use proximity sensing units to unlock and start automobiles without physically placing the key. Replicating smart keys usually needs car dealership service due to the complexity of programming.
How to Obtain Duplicate Car Keys
Getting a duplicate car key can be done through numerous techniques. Below are the most common techniques:
1. Regional Locksmith
Going to a local locksmith is often the most convenient technique for replicating standard keys. It is recommended to confirm the locksmith's credentials and guarantee they have experience in automotive keys.
2. Car Dealership
For transponder keys, key fobs, and smart keys, dealers typically provide the most reliable services. However, this option can be more costly and may require evidence of ownership.
3. Hardware Store
Some hardware shops have key duplication services that handle standard keys. It's a quicker and often less expensive alternative, though it might not appropriate for advanced key types.
4. Mobile Key Cutting Services
With the increase of innovation, mobile key cutting services have actually emerged, enabling locksmith professionals to come to your place. These services can often accommodate various key types, consisting of smart keys.
